    Which place in Himachal Pradesh is called "Mini Switzerland"?

    Question #115242. Asked by armindasantana. (Jun 13 10 3:41 PM)


    sarahcateh

    Khajjiar. It is called such because the presence of lush meadows and dense forest, all sitting at the feet of snowy Himalayan mountains gives it the appearance of a Swiss landscape.
